About Criminal Litigation Law in Brasov, Romania
Criminal litigation in Brasov, Romania, involves the legal process where state prosecution is pursued against an individual or entity accused of committing a crime. This form of litigation encompasses all legal proceedings from the investigation stage through to trial and possible appeal. Brasov, a city with a unique blend of history and modernity, operates within the Romanian legal framework, which is based on civil law traditions. The city, known for its vibrant tourism industry and rich cultural heritage, has legal institutions such as courts and law enforcement agencies equipped to handle a wide variety of criminal cases.

Local Laws Overview
Romanian criminal law is codified primarily in the Penal Code and related legislation. In Brasov, as elsewhere in Romania, certain laws and legal principles are particularly pertinent:
- Presumption of Innocence: Accused individuals are considered innocent until proven guilty beyond a reasonable doubt.
- Legal Representation: The right to defense is guaranteed, making access to a lawyer critical.
- Detention and Arrest Rules: Strict guidelines exist around lawful detention, emphasizing human rights protections.
- Trial Procedure: Criminal proceedings generally involve investigation, pre-trial, trial, and possible appeal stages, adhering to scheduled legal protocols.
Frequently Asked Questions
What should I do if I’m arrested in Brasov?
If arrested, it's crucial to stay calm, ask for a lawyer, and avoid making statements without legal counsel present.
How can I find a qualified criminal defense lawyer in Brasov?
Look for lawyers specializing in criminal law, check local bar association directories, or seek recommendations from trusted sources.
What are my rights during a criminal investigation?
You have the right to legal counsel, to remain silent, and to be informed of the charges against you, among other protections.
Can I represent myself in a criminal trial?
While possible, self-representation is not advisable due to the complexity of legal procedures and potential consequences.
What happens if I cannot afford a lawyer?
The Romanian legal system provides for public defenders if you cannot afford private legal representation.
What are some potential outcomes of a criminal trial?
Outcomes can range from acquittal to fines, community service, probation, or imprisonment, depending on the case specifics.
How long does a criminal trial typically last?
Trial duration varies with case complexity, but the process can span several months to years, including appeals.
What is a plea bargain, and is it an option in Romania?
Plea bargaining is negotiating a reduced sentence or charges in exchange for a guilty plea; it is available under certain conditions.
Can charges be dropped before trial?
Yes, charges can be dismissed if evidence is insufficient or procedural errors occur during the investigation.
Will a criminal record affect my future opportunities?
Yes, a criminal record can impact job prospects, travel, and other life opportunities, making legal representation important.
